1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ique on the web by which a long URL might be converted right into a shorter, extra workable type. This shortened URL redirects to the original very long URL when visited. Services like Bitly and TinyURL are well-acknowledged exam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the appearance of social media platforms like Twitter, the place character boundaries for posts created it challenging to share very long URLs.

Over and above social websites, URL shorteners are handy in marketing campaigns, e-mail, and printed media the place very long URLs is often cumbersome.

two. Core Components of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ener usually contains the subsequent components:

World wide web Interface: This is the front-conclude element in which consumers can enter their long URLs and get shortened versions. It may be a simple form on a Online page.
Databases: A databases is critical to shop the mapping in between the original long URL and also the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L possibilities like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that usually takes the small URL and redirects the consumer for the corresponding lengthy URL. This logic is normally applied in the net server or an software layer.
API: Quite a few URL shorteners supply an API to ensure 3rd-bash applications can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first extended URLs.
3. Building the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a lengthy URL into a brief one particular. Several solutions might be utilized, such as:

Hashing: The long URL might be hashed into a hard and fast-size string, which serves since the brief URL. However, hash collisions (different URLs leading to a similar h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one popular method is to implement Base62 encoding (which works by using 62 characters: 0-9, A-Z, as well as a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ry inside the databases. This technique ensures that the shorter URL is as limited as you possibly can.
Random String Technology: Yet another strategy will be to create a random string of a set length (e.g., six people) and check if it’s presently in use during the databases. If not, it’s assigned on the very long URL.
4. Databases Management
The database schema for any URL shortener will likely be easy, with two Main fields:

ID: A novel identifier for each URL entry.
Extended URL: The first URL that needs to be shortened.
Small URL/Slug: The short Variation on the URL, frequently stored as a unique string.
As well as these, you may want to shop metadata like the generation day, expiration date, and the number of periods the brief URL has become accessed.

5.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is actually a vital Section of the URL shortener's Procedure. When a consumer clicks on a short URL, the provider ought to quickly retrieve the initial URL in the database and redirect the user working with an HTTP 301 (long-lasting redirect) or 302 (temporary redirect) status code.

Overall performance is essential listed here, as the process really should be almost instantaneous. Procedures like database indexing and caching (e.g., working with Redis or Memcached) may be utilized to hurry up the retrieval method.

six. Security Factors
Stability is a substantial wor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ener may be abused to unfold destructive one-way links. Implementing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-occasion stability solutions to examine URLs before shortening them can mitigate this hazard.
Spam Avoidance: Amount restricting and CAPTCHA can prevent abuse by spammers attempting to create thousands of quick URLs.
seven. Scalability
As the URL shortener grows, it may have to take care of an incredible number of UR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ute traffic across numerous servers to handle substantial masses.
Distributed Databases: Use databases which will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ual problems like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into unique products and services to further impro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ners typically give analytics to track how frequently a brief URL is clicked, in which the site visitors is coming from, along with other useful metrics. This requires logging Just about every red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.
